Output 3d7709d90f3e01552d4aeb85589f0ca24b15e116ec239432c01260d3a1469d50:11

value
688901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 696af2ca1acbaafac136dc97d49fe9260cc071db OP_EQUAL
address
3BJQzbDhts5kbB4hDUEczGWRqxDBx6GvG8
transaction
3d7709d90f3e01552d4aeb85589f0ca24b15e116ec239432c01260d3a1469d50
spent
true